

In New Zealand over 3500 sexual offences are recorded every year, in the past 12 months child abuse submissions to Auckland’s Starship Hospital are the worst on record and each week in New Zealand there are 5 cases of kidnapping and abduction.
Presented by Greg Boyed, Crime Scene brings the public to the crime scene to help police solve a series of related sexual attacks that has put a city under siege. We revisit the scene of a botched abduction, and seek your help in solving a series of crimes committed in New Zealand over recent weeks and months.
Crime Scene takes a closer look at child abuse, looking for answers and ways to stamp out this national tragedy. We get an insiders account of street gangs in New Zealand, and find out just who is ruling your neighbourhood.
Criminal profiling is critical in the fight against crime. In this edition of Crime Scene we explore the forensics used to solve cases and take a look into the mind of one of New Zealand’s most notorious serial rapists.
While crime poses a threat to everyone there are extraordinary acts of bravery committed by members of the public and emergency services that save people from becoming victims. Crime Scene tells the story of a hero whose action saves the life of a young child and potentially many others.
Crime Scene will once again put the spotlight on crime and ask the New Zealand public for information via telephone, text and email. It will also look at current crime around the country, as well as provide useful information on keeping safe.
